Rivals Connacht, taken by surprise, couldn’t handle the Dragons’ fiery spirit, resulting in a dramatic 48-28 win for the Newport-based squad. Stuart Lancaster, Connacht’s head coach, admitted his team was outclassed and praised the Dragons for their incredible play and relentless intensity. Meanwhile, Gareth Davies of Scarlets proves age is just a number. The 35-year-old veteran seems to be getting better with time, dazzling fans with his speedy moves and tactical brilliance. He scored twice against Cardiff at the Arms Park, even intercepting a pass to sprint 65 metres for a try. His performance didn’t just secure a 21-17 victory for Scarlets but also moved him up the all-time try list! πŸƒβ€β™‚οΈπŸŒŸ

Scarlets’ forwards coach Albert van den Berg compared Davies to a fine wine, saying, “Some players, as they get older, they get better.” Wise words indeed! 🍷

Elsewhere, Glasgow Warriors claimed a hard-fought 24-12 derby victory over Edinburgh in the 1872 Cup clash at Hampden. Coach Franco Smith was unfazed by the lack of flashy play, emphasising the gritty, strategic battle that delivered results. Edinburgh’s coach Sean Everitt remains optimistic for a comeback, noting the opportunity to turn things around in the next leg. 🏟️πŸ’ͺ
